Introduction to Adverse Impact Analysis
As artificial intelligence (AI) continues to permeate various aspects of our lives, from healthcare to hiring processes, the need for robust bias detection mechanisms has become more critical than ever. Adverse impact analysis plays a pivotal role in identifying and mitigating biases within AI systems. These biases can inadvertently influence decision-making, often leading to unintended consequences for protected groups. This article delves into the intricacies of adverse impact analysis, highlighting its significance, methodologies, and the ongoing efforts to address bias in AI.
Types of Bias in AI
Selection Bias
Selection bias occurs when the training data used to build AI models does not accurately represent the real-world scenario. This can lead to skewed outcomes that favor certain groups while disadvantaging others. For instance, if an AI recruitment tool is trained predominantly on resumes from one gender, it may inherently favor that gender in its hiring recommendations.
Stereotyping Bias
Stereotyping bias reinforces harmful stereotypes through AI outputs. This bias can manifest in language models that associate certain occupations or roles predominantly with one gender or race, perpetuating societal stereotypes. Addressing this bias is crucial to ensuring that AI systems promote inclusivity and fairness.
Out-group Homogeneity Bias
Out-group homogeneity bias refers to the tendency of AI systems to struggle with distinguishing between individuals outside the majority group. This bias can lead to inaccuracies in facial recognition systems, where individuals from minority groups are often misidentified, resulting in significant adverse outcomes.
Identifying Systemic Biases
Data Collection and Analysis
Biases can be embedded in AI systems during the data collection and analysis phase. If the data collected is not diverse or representative of the entire population, the AI model trained on this data will likely inherit these biases, leading to skewed results.
Algorithmic Bias
Algorithmic bias arises from the design and implementation of AI algorithms. Even the most well-intentioned algorithms can produce biased outcomes if they rely on biased data or are not designed to account for potential disparities among different groups.
Human Factors
Human biases can also infiltrate AI systems. Developers and data scientists bring their own conscious or unconscious biases into the AI development process, which can inadvertently influence the design and functionality of AI models.
Technical Approaches to Bias Detection
Parity-based Methods
Parity-based methods involve examining the outcomes of AI models to ensure fairness across different groups. This approach focuses on achieving an equal distribution of outcomes, such as equal hiring rates across genders in recruitment tools.
Information Theory Methods
Information theory methods analyze datasets for fairness by quantifying the amount of information shared across different groups. These methods help identify disparities and ensure that AI models do not disproportionately favor one group over another.
Cross-dataset Bias Detection
Cross-dataset bias detection involves comparing multiple datasets to identify inconsistencies and biases. By examining how different datasets perform against each other, developers can pinpoint areas where biases may exist and take corrective action.
Saliency Maps and Feature Importance
Techniques such as saliency maps and feature importance provide insights into model decisions by highlighting the features that most influence the output. Understanding these influences helps identify potential biases and adjust the model accordingly.
Real-world Examples and Case Studies
Numerous real-world examples illustrate the impact of AI bias, such as facial recognition systems misidentifying individuals from minority groups or language translation tools perpetuating gender stereotypes. Case studies of successful bias mitigation strategies, like IBM’s algorithmic reviews and Facebook’s advertising policy changes, showcase effective approaches to reducing AI bias.
Actionable Insights and Best Practices
Data Curation
Ensuring diverse and representative training data is a fundamental step in mitigating bias. By curating high-quality datasets, developers can reduce the risk of introducing biases into AI models.
Algorithm Auditing
Regularly reviewing algorithms for bias is essential for maintaining fairness. Algorithm audits can identify potential biases and allow for timely interventions to correct any issues.
Human Oversight
Involving diverse teams in the AI development process is vital for identifying and addressing biases. A diverse team brings varied perspectives, helping to mitigate the risk of biases being overlooked.
Tools and Platforms for Bias Detection
Several AI tools and platforms, like Insight7 and others, are designed to assist in bias detection. These tools leverage natural language processing and machine learning techniques to analyze datasets and identify potential biases, providing valuable insights for developers and data scientists.
Challenges & Solutions
Challenges in Bias Detection
Identifying subtle biases and the lack of diverse datasets remain significant challenges in bias detection. These issues can hinder efforts to create fair and equitable AI systems.
Solutions
Implementing diverse data collection methods, using advanced AI tools for bias detection, and fostering a culture of transparency are effective solutions to these challenges. By prioritizing these strategies, organizations can work towards developing unbiased AI systems.
Latest Trends & Future Outlook
Recent Developments
Advances in AI bias detection techniques and tools highlight the growing emphasis on ethical AI development. These developments are crucial for ensuring AI systems operate fairly and transparently.
Future Trends
The integration of AI ethics into mainstream AI development and the establishment of regulatory frameworks for bias mitigation are key future trends. These initiatives will guide the development of fair and accountable AI systems.
Emerging Technologies
Technologies such as Explainable AI (XAI) are playing an increasingly important role in enhancing transparency and fairness in AI systems. By providing insights into AI decision-making processes, XAI helps identify and address biases more effectively.
Conclusion
Understanding adverse impact analysis is crucial for detecting bias in AI systems. As AI continues to influence various sectors, ensuring fairness and accountability in these systems is of paramount importance. By employing robust bias detection methodologies and fostering interdisciplinary collaboration, we can work towards developing AI systems that are not only technologically advanced but also ethically sound. The future of AI lies in our ability to address these challenges and create systems that reflect the diverse and inclusive society we strive to achieve.